Driving licenses are essential for all residents of Sindh, including Karachi, before driving on the roads. Not having a valid license can lead to fines or penalties. The Driving License Sindh department issues licenses for cars, motorcycles, and other vehicles after individuals pass theoretical and practical exams. Anyone 18 years or older, regardless of gender, can apply for a license.

Before going to the D.L Branch, individuals must get an Online Pre-Appointment. After getting the pre-appointment token, applicants need to go to the designated branch with their original CNIC. They must then undergo a medical check-up by a certified medical officer to comply with the Motor Vehicle Ordinance -1965.

Prior to getting a permanent license, applicants must first get a learner's license, valid for one year. Permanent car and motorcycle licenses are issued by the traffic department for three or five years. The government has no plans to change the fee structure, with a Car + Motorcycle license for three years costing Rs1,410 and Rs1,860 for five years.
